Sep 28, 2017 · Grass is Greener Syndrome is when someone believes what they currently have is no longer adequate, satisfying, ample, or enough. Because of this, doubt creeps in and the belief that "better is out there" is adopted and acted upon. This is generally followed by a complete lack of regard for the emotional casualties upon exit.

The ‘All-or-Nothing’ Problem. Grass is greener syndrome tends to be a very black-and-white process. Some needs are fully being met, and other needs are totally neglected. There’s very little room or tolerance in grass is greener process for middle ground and emotional compromise without feeling like you’re starving in one area or another.
